مشکل در رسپانسیو شدن سایت هنگام استفاده از بوت استرپ
علیرغم تمام تلاشهام سایتم رسپانسیو نمیشه خیلی عجیبه حتی مثالهای ساده ای که دیدم و دقیقا عمل می کنه بعد از کپی به سایت بدرستی عمل نمی کنه همه می گن رسپانسیو کردن سایت خیلی سادست اما داره دیونه کننده میشه در asp.net 2008 بیش از 1000تا error از فایل css بوت استرپ می گیره فایلی که از خود سایت اصلیش دانلود کردم هر چند خطاها مانع کار نمیشن جداول اصلا ریسپانسیو نمیشن و فقط سایتهای تک صفحه ساده رسپانسیو میشن
پاسخ هوش مصنوعی
برای حل مشکلات رسپانسیو شدن سایت شما با استفاده از بوت استرپ، می توانید نکات زیر را بررسی کنید:
اطمینان حاصل کنید که فایل های CSS و JS بوت استرپ به درستی به پروژه شما متصل شده اند. معمولاً این فایل ها در بخش
<head>
قرار می گیرند.برچسب متا viewport را اضافه کنید تا برای دستگاه های مختلف به درستی نمایش داده شود:
<meta name="viewport" content="width=device-width, initial-scale=1.0">
از کلاس های بوت استرپ به درستی استفاده کنید. به عنوان مثال، برای جداول، می توانید از کلاس
table-responsive
استفاده کنید:
<div class="table-responsive">
<table class="table">
<thead>
<tr>
<th>عنوان 1</th>
<th>عنوان 2</th>
</tr>
</thead>
<tbody>
<tr>
<td>محتوا 1</td>
<td>محتوا 2</td>
</tr>
</tbody>
</table>
</div>
اگر از المان های سفارشی استفاده می کنید، اطمینان حاصل کنید که هیچگونه CSS سفارشی که باعث تداخل شده و مانع از عملکرد صحیح بوت استرپ شود، وجود ندارد.
در نهایت، خطاهای موجود در فایل CSS خود را بررسی کنید و سعی کنید این خطاها را برطرف کنید. این خطاها می توانند بر روی نحوه ی نمایش المان ها تأثیر بگذارند.
با رعایت موارد بالا، می توانید مطمین شوید که سایت تان رسپانسیو خواهد شد.
ببینید بهتره برای اینکه بشه کمک کرد کدهایی که نوشتید رو قرار بدید. مثلا فایلهای css و jquery که به پروژه لینک کردید رو اضافه نمایش بدید.
بنظرم برای این کار ابتدا یک پروژه خالی و ساده ایجاد کنید و فریم ورک بوت استرپ رو بهش اضافه کنید و با کلاس های اون مقدار کار کنید تا اگر هم خطایی وجود داره بتونید راحتتر اون مشکل رو حل کنید.
وقتی شما در یک پروژه از قبل آماده میاید و فریم ورک Bootstrap رو اضافه می کنید کلی خطا ممکنه بریزه بیرون بخاطر استایل ها و فایلهای قبلی که کارتون سخت میشه.
مشکلات با سایت w3school حل شد خیلی زیبا و ساده توضیح داده بود.
- آموزش استفاده از پلاگین گردونه شانس در Asp.net core به همراه سورس
- نمایش متن به صورت فرمت شده در CkEditor
- آموزش استفاده از SignalR در Asp.net Core با مثال عملی
- ادغام چند گزارش استیمول سافت بصورت پی دی اف در یک فایل
- نحوه تغییر استایل کامپوننت select2 چگونه است ؟
- چگونه امنیت پروژه را در Asp.net Core افزایش دهیم ؟
- ارسال پارامتر در دستور window.open جی کویری
- ارسال پارامتر از طریق جاوااسکریپت با کلیک روی تگ a
- خطای 500 زمان اجرا شدن پروژه روی هاست
- کویری نویسی در استیمول سافت جهت فیلتر اطلاعات
- احراز هویت از طریق اکتیو دایرکتوری
- معنی و مفهوم و کاربرد Thread pool در وب
- نحوه حذف پس زمینه سیاه صفحه مدال در بوت استرپ
- منظور از فرانت اند و بک اند چیست ؟
- نمایش منو با راست کلیک کردن روی Ckeditor
- علت کند شدن سایت در Asp.net core
- انتقال کاربر به مسیر خاص بعد از لاگین در Asp.net core
- کار با رویداد SelectedDateChanged در کامپوننت تاریخ شمسی در سی شارپ
- نمایش گزارش StimulSoft در Asp.net Web form
- انتخاب MVC یا Core برای طراحی سایتی که با Asp.net پیاده سازی شده است